Basics for the start
-
u:account – personal uni account
The u:account is the central user account system of the University of Vienna. It provides students, staff, and applicants with access to the University’s online services and IT systems.
-
u:card for employees
The u:card works both as an employee ID card and as a library card. Employees who are currently employed with the University of Vienna can order their u:card via u:space.
-
u:find
In u:find you can find all courses offered at the University of Vienna (organised according to semesters), as well as all university departments, units and employees.

University Sports Institute (USI)
The USI offers around 1,200 sports courses across 160 disciplines. Courses are available to all students, graduates, and university employees at very affordable rates.
-
Language Center of the University of Vienna (Sprachenzentrum)
Language courses for German and more than 30 foreign languages. Employees of the University of Vienna receive a discount on courses.
